Belswains Playing Field
Belswains Playing Field is a park in Dacorum District, Hertfordshire, England. Belswains Playing Field is situated nearby to the playground Coronation Fields Play Area, as well as near the doctor’s office Bennetts End Surgery.Places of Interest Nearby

Bennetts End
Suburb
Photo: Nigel Cox,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Bennetts End is a neighbourhood within Hemel Hempstead in Hertfordshire, England. It is located in the southeast of the town and consists almost entirely of public housing built as part of the new town in the 1950s.

Apsley
Suburb
Photo: PAUL FARMER,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Apsley is a village in Hertfordshire, England, in a valley of the Chiltern Hills below the confluence of the River Gade and Bulbourne. It was the site of water mills serving local agriculture and from the early 19th century became an important centre for papermaking.
